EPISODE CONTEXT

Coming off the heavier confrontations of Episode 5, Episode 6 serves as a well-placed breather at the season's halfway mark, pivoting to comedy and ensemble building. It expands the cast with Heisuke Mashimo, a key addition who deepens the world of retired and active assassins orbiting Sakamoto. With five episodes remaining, this introduction positions new dynamics and alliances that will likely pay off as the season escalates toward its back half.
